Skopje, 13 May 2016 – In its second report on the monitoring of media coverage in the news following the calling of elections, which covers the period 25 April-4 May 2016, the Agency for Audio and Audiovisual Media Services has concluded that the Alfa TV, Kanal 5 TV and Sitel TV had been reporting on the activities of the government authorities as means of election-related media coverage of VMRO/DPMNE. Misdemeanour procedures have been initiated against the detected offences.[…]

Broadcasters should submit recordings of their PPA price list announcements
Skopje, 06.05.2016 – The Agency for Audio and Audiovisual Media Services wishes to remind all broadcasters who have submitted price lists for paid political advertising, that, in line with the provisions of Article 75-f, Point 4 of the Electoral Code, they are obligated to announce their adopted PPA price lists in their programme at least twice before the start of the election campaign, which, according to the adopted Schedule of the State Election Commission, commences on 16 May 2016.[…]

Reports on ad hoc supervisions following SDSM’s complaints
Skopje, 15.04.2016 – Based on six complaints submitted by the Social-Democratic Alliance of Macedonia, the Agency conducted several ad hoc supervisions over the programmes of the national televisions of Alfa TV, Kanal 5 TV, Nova TV and Sitel TV. The complaints concerned the observance of the principles under Article 61 of the Law on Audio and Audiovisual Media Services. The supervision found several instances of non-observance of the law. The Agency has notified the televisions about the findings. The details established by the supervision are given in the reports.[…]
